About the Role

The Specialist/Coordinator is responsible for maintaining contracting platforms internally and externally for PACS affiliated facilities. Directly supports the Managed Care Department by completing Health Plan applications, submitting credentialing documents, notifying facilities on contracts, and providing education on accessing contracts.

Responsibilities

  • Maintain credentialing status of Skilled Nursing Facilities with Health Plans by submitting credentialing applications and required documentation in a timely manner.
  • Maintain a shared drive that houses all facility credentials and licenses.
  • Perform regular audits of certifications and update Health Plans to ensure compliance.
  • Assist the Managed Care Department with the Health Plan contracting process, including credentialing, proper filing/loading of contracts, and notifying facilities.
  • Register and renew facilities with SAM.gov, and maintain an intricate data record to track registration and status.
  • Maintain facility profiles and documents in Credentialing Point.
  • Assist with setting up MNS training with facilities for authorization and claims access.
  • Coordinate with MNS on loading new or revised credentialing documents.
  • Complete Health Plan Credentialing documents in Credentialing Point.
  • Provide contracting support.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ned.
